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
87 1629451 96096042616
3979 83
3979 83
92 03 291118
All about undefined
Interested in learning more?
3979 83
92 03 291118
See more
61348013 21716 59877943
05 99043 561
See more
70 907 35958094164
4697 78378850636 392072959
See more